defensive柯林斯释义

ADJ防御(性)的;防卫(用)的;保护的

You use defensive to describe things that are intended to protect someone or something.

  • The Government hastily organized defensive measures against the raids...

    政府急忙布置了防卫措施抵御空袭。

  • The union leaders were pushed into a more defensive position by the return of a Republican Congress in November.

    由于 11 月份共和党重新控制了国会,工会领导人被推到更加被动防守的位置。

ADJ-GRADED(表现在行为上)防御的,戒备的,卫护的

Someone who is defensive is behaving in a way that shows they feel unsure or threatened.

  • Like their children, parents are often defensive about their private lives.

    就像子女一样,父母也常常很注重保护他们的私生活。

  • She heard the blustering, defensive note in his voice and knew that he was ashamed.

    她听出他话音里的气势汹汹和自我卫护,知道他感到了羞愧。

PHRASE处于防御姿态;处于守势

If someone is on the defensive, they are trying to protect themselves or their interests because they feel unsure or threatened.

  • Accusations are likely to put the other person on the defensive...

    谴责很可能会引发对方自我防卫的反应。

  • He smiled, not wanting to put the man on the defensive.

    他笑了笑,不想让那个人产生抵触情绪。

ADJ-GRADED(体育运动中的打法)防守(型)的

In sports, defensive play is play that is intended to prevent your opponent from scoring goals or points against you.

  • I'd always played a defensive game, waiting for my opponent to make a mistake.

    我总是采取防守型的打法,等待对手出错。

defensive英文释义

Noun

1. an attitude of defensiveness (especially in the phrase `on the defensive')

    Adjective

    1. intended or appropriate for defending against or deterring aggression or attack;

    • defensive weapons
    • a defensive stance

    2. attempting to justify or defend in speech or writing

      3. serving as or appropriate for defending or protecting;

      • defensive fortifications
      • defensive dikes to protect against floods
